Pueblo native trains for his next Guinness World Record attempt
PUEBLO WEST, Colo. (KRDO) - 46-year-old Frank Sagona has a strong case for best pull up master in the world. He's done millions of them over the last 16 years. He's done most of those at his home in Pueblo and gym in Pueblo West. Sagona has two standing Guinness World Records: 1010 chin ups in one hour. 5049 pull ups in eight hours. Guinness World record for world’s largest hockey festival - The Hockey Paper
In the lush hills of Kodagu, a remarkable sporting and cultural phenomenon has reached a new milestone.
